AuDHD and me
In this episode I chat to the inspirational James Hunt. James is a devoted father and advocate for autism awareness. He shares his experiences raising two autistic sons and building a supportive community through social media and his clothing brand. We explore the nuances of communication, acceptance, and the power of connection in family life with autism. In this episode: * James shares his motivations behind creating the "Stories About Autism" Instagram account and the impact it has had on his family and others. * The significance of community, sharing, and catharsis in mental health and advocacy. * Deep insights into non-speaking versus non-verbal communication and the importance of understanding different ways autistic individuals communicate. * Celebrating small joys and moments of achievement, especially breakthroughs in communication like texting. * The story behind James Hunt's clothing brand advocating neurodiversity and its role in fostering acceptance and connection. * The process of writing a heartfelt book about navigating autism, life's unexpected challenges, and finding hope amid difficulty. * James's hopes for his sons' future, emphasizing independence, happiness, and experiencing the world fully. * Practical advice for families, parents, and allies to create inclusive environments and embrace neurodivergence.
